Introduction

Antimil is a prescription medication that contains the active ingredient Artemether. It is available in the form of an injection and is commonly prescribed for the treatment of certain types of malaria infections.

Uses

Antimil is primarily used for the treatment of uncomplicated malaria caused by Plasmodium falciparum. It is particularly effective in regions where the malaria parasite has developed resistance to other antimalarial medications.

Dosage and Administration

Antimil should be administered under the supervision of a healthcare professional. The dosage and duration of treatment may vary depending on the severity of the malaria infection and other individual factors. Follow the instructions provided by your healthcare provider. The injection is typically administered into a muscle, such as the thigh or buttock.

Mechanism of Action

Artemether, the active ingredient in Antimil, belongs to a class of medications known as artemisinin derivatives. It works by interfering with the growth and reproduction of the malaria parasite within the red blood cells. This helps to reduce the number of parasites in the body and alleviate the symptoms of malaria.

Side Effects

Common side effects may include nausea, vomiting, dizziness, headache, and muscle pain. These side effects are usually mild and transient.

However, some individuals may experience more serious side effects, such as allergic reactions, severe skin rashes, or changes in blood cell counts. If you experience any unusual or severe side effects, seek medical attention immediately.

Drug Interactions

inform your healthcare provider about all medications you are currently taking, including over-the-counter drugs, herbal supplements, and vitamins. Certain medications may interact with Antimil, potentially affecting its effectiveness or increasing the risk of side effects. Common drug interactions may include certain anticoagulants, anticonvulsants, and antiretroviral drugs. Consult with your healthcare provider to ensure the safe and effective use of Antimil.

Precautions

Before using Antimil, inform your healthcare provider about any medical conditions you have, including liver or kidney problems. Additionally, mention any allergies or sensitivities you may have to medications or other substances.

Antimil should be used with caution in individuals with a history of cardiac disorders or electrolyte imbalances. It is also contraindicated in individuals with a known hypersensitivity to Artemether or any other component of the injection.
